Abstract

Islam is a merciful religion that places great emphasis on the welfare of its people in various aspects of life. Furthermore, this is demonstrated by the fourth pillars of Islam; the payment of zakat. Paying zakat is obligatory for all Muslims and will be distributed through the zakat institution to eight special groups of zakat recipients known as asnaf, which include the poor (fakir), the needy (al-masakin), amil, muallaf, al-riqab, al-gharimin, ibn al-sabil, and fi sabilillah. Currently, zakat institutions are facing contemporary jurisprudential issues, especially regarding the issue of expanding the concept of al-riqab according to current needs. In addition, there is a suggestion to expand the concept of al-riqab for the rehabilitation of mentally ill people, which raises questions among the Muslim community about the relevance of the suggestion. This study aims to examine the perception of the Muslim community towards the proposed expansion of the al-riqab concept for the rehabilitation of mentally ill people. This qualitative study uses document analysis and structured interviews as data collection methods. The results of this study showed that the community was divided into two groups in giving their views about this proposal. The respondents who showed their agreement on the view mentioned that it is significant because of the need of financing of treatment cost, while those who showed disagreement said that this proposal is not significant because it does not meet the criteria of al-riqab. Therefore, this study suggests that the zakat institution consider the proposed expansion of the concept of al-riqab for the rehabilitation of mental patients. Future studies need to discuss on the opinions of scholars and experts in the field.
